The story recounts a “fork-fried eggs” method taught by the narrator’s father while cooking at a friend’s house using propane heat. With the skillet hot, he had the narrator grab a fork, add a touch of oil, and then cook the eggs. The key step: after the eggs hit the pan and sizzle, the father used the fork to poke about a dozen tiny holes through the egg white, followed by only the slightest stir. He argued that high heat breaks down membranes and that the punctures help the egg white set thicker around the yolk. The takeaway is simple—poke the eggs for a firmer fried result.
